THIS OPPORTUNITY
WSP is currently initiating a search for a Project Manager- Power & Energy in our Power & Energy team in Amarillo, TX. This is also a remote position with the ability to work from a mutually acceptable WSP office location. This position advances the successful delivery of large, complex, and high-risk projects by leading the design and execution of integrated project risk strategies. The role applies deep technical knowledge and analytical expertise to evaluate critical uncertainties and drive effective mitigation plans that protect performance across cost, schedule, and scope. By serving as a trusted advisor to project and program leadership, this position strengthens decision-making and promotes a consistent, enterprise-aligned approach to risk management. It also contributes to organizational learning and operational excellence through the refinement of tools, training, and governance frameworks.YOUR IMPACT
• Provides leadership in the development and implementation of robust project risk management frameworks tailored to the complexity and scale of major capital and infrastructure programs. • Collaborates with program directors, project managers, and technical leads to assess critical risk exposures across financial, schedule, technical, regulatory, and reputational domains. • Facilitates high-level risk identification and evaluation workshops using structured tools and scenario-based techniques. • Oversees the preparation and validation of quantitative risk analyses, including probabilistic simulations and risk-adjusted forecasts. • Advises on contingency requirements, escalation protocols, and mitigation strategies to support project governance and financial planning. • Monitors risk response actions across multiple disciplines and ensures accountability for timely and effective mitigation. • Supports the integration of risk outputs into overall project controls, including cost management, scheduling, earned value, and forecasting. • Develops and maintains comprehensive risk registers, heat maps, and dashboards that provide executive-level insight into risk status and trends. • Delivers risk briefings and reports to senior leadership, clients, and steering committees, clearly communicating high-impact exposures and required actions. • Provides subject matter expertise on risk provisions during contract reviews and supports claim analysis and dispute resolution. • Serves as a mentor and coach to risk professionals, building internal capabilities through knowledge-sharing, training, and peer review. • Leads lessons learned reviews, root cause investigations, and after-action assessments to drive continuous improvement. • Contributes to enterprise-level risk initiatives, including standardization of templates, procedures, and performance metrics. • Ensures alignment of risk management practices with WSP’s project delivery methodology and applicable client or regulatory standards. • Evaluates risk interdependencies across workstreams, interfaces, and external stakeholders. • Leads proactive identification of emerging risk themes and anticipates macro-level developments that may impact project execution • Leads strategic risk input during proposal development and business pursuits by assessing risk exposure and contributing to strategic positioning. • Engages with external consultants, legal teams, and insurance providers to coordinate specialized risk support. • Maintains thorough documentation to support audits, funding reviews, and internal governance processes. • Advises project leadership on balancing risk exposure with opportunity optimization in pursuit of client and business outcomes. • Supports digital transformation initiatives in risk management by evaluating and implementing data-driven tools and analytics. • Collaborates with global colleagues to share best practices and maintain consistency in approach. • Exercise responsible and ethical decision-making regarding company funds, resources, and conduct, and adhere to WSP’s Code of Conduct and related policies and procedures. • Perform additional responsibilities as required by business needs.WHO YOU ARE
Required Qualifications • Bachelor’s Degree in Business Administration, Project Management, Engineering, or a closely related discipline, or demonstrated proven equivalent experience. • 10+ years of relevant post-education experience in project risk management or related areas. • Deep understanding of project and program risk management methodologies, tools, and lifecycle application. • Advanced proficiency with quantitative risk modeling techniques, including Monte Carlo simulations. • Experience supporting complex, multi-disciplinary projects in sectors such as infrastructure, transportation, or energy. • Proven ability to design and implement risk frameworks aligned with organizational strategy and project scale. • Strong facilitation skills and experience leading risk identification and assessment workshops at senior levels. • Skilled in synthesizing technical and commercial risk information for diverse audiences, including clients and executives. • Ability to translate complex risk profiles into actionable mitigation strategies and monitoring plans. • Demonstrated capability in integrating risk with cost, schedule, and earned value systems. • Track record of managing risk programs across concurrent projects or programs. • Proficient in the use of risk tools such as Primavera Risk Analysis, @RISK, or similar. •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to influence decision-making. • Ability to lead multidisciplinary teams through the development of risk mitigation and response strategies. • Experience developing KPIs and dashboards for risk reporting and performance tracking. • Understanding of contractual risk allocation, commercial strategy, and procurement models.- Familiarity with ISO 31000, AACE, or equivalent risk management standards.

About WSP WSP USA is the U.S. operating company of WSP, one of the world's leading engineering and professional services firms. Dedicated to serving local communities, we are engineers, planners, technical experts, strategic advisors and construction management professionals. WSP USA designs lasting solutions in the buildings, transportation, energy, water and environment markets. With more than 15,000 employees in over 300 offices across the U.S., we partner with our clients to help communities prosper.
